Intensity safety
On
:
When Intensity safety is on, no stimulus intensities higher than 115 dB SPL (measured in a 2cc
cavity) can be selected or will be applied.
Off
:
Stimulus intensities up to the technical limits of the device and probe can be selected and
applied. A warning triangle is displayed on-screen whenever intensities above 115 dB SPL are
selected.
Intensity safety is automatically set to
On
whenever the
Ear Selector
button is toggled or a
new patient folder is selected.
Note
•
Whenever a stimulus level exceeds the warning level (> 108 dB SPL re 2cc), the
stimulus intensity value will start flashing and all automatic testing is paused. You are
then prompted to decide whether to continue or to move on to the next stimulus type.
In Manual testing, whenever a stimulus level exceeds the Intensity Safetp.buy level
((> 115 dB SPL re 2cc), the stimulus intensity value will start flashing.
Warning
•
When you test on small ears, the sound pressure level will increase in the
ear canal. It is therefore not recommended to exceed the warning level when testing
on patients with small ear canals.
Default:
On
